Garry Disher Books in Order

Garry Disher is a prolific Australian author born in 1949. He spent his formative years on his family's farm in South Australia. Disher holds postgraduate degrees from the esteemed institutions of Adelaide and Melbourne Universities. In 1978, he secured a creative writing fellowship to Stanford University, where he crafted his debut short story collection. Disher has since traversed the globe, absorbing diverse influences and experiences that have shaped his writing. Upon his return to Australia, he turned to teaching creative writing, before finally dedicating himself to a full-time writing career in 1988. As a versatile author, Disher has penned over 40 titles, encompassing genres such as general and crime fiction, children's literature, textbooks, and insightful guides on the craft of writing.
